Spring Break is a week full of fun, excitement, and making memories that will be with you forever.  However, in order to make this week the best it can be and to make sure you return back to campus safely follow these simple rules.

  1. We all know what spring break is all about, so to make sure you are staying healthy and hydrated by drinking all the water you can get.
  2. Prior to Spring Break most of us start our pre-tan at the tanning salon so that we don’t appear washed out from the lack of Nebraskan sun. Either way, once you get to your location be sure to lather up in sunscreen to prevent from looking like a lobster.
  3. The most important rule that you should remember for the sake of your own safety is to NEVER go anywhere alone. Always remember the buddy system and travel in groups of at least three to four people to avoid any reckless activity.

Follow these simple guidelines and the amount of fun you are having will be all you need to worry about!
